Cruising down the “The Old King’s Highway” is a must for New England travelers. Connecting the mainland to the tip of Cape Cod, Highway 6A is one of the most scenic coastal routes in the United States, and your entrance to the quintessential shore holiday. The Provincetown Art Association and... pyjama fille 10 ansWebFeb 15, 2024 · Around mid- April, Cape Cod whale watching season begins, and it runs through October. The best time to see the whales, though, is from June through September because this is their peak migration period. Throughout the season, you’re very likely to see multiple whales on a boat trip.
